Breakthroughs In Low-Profile Leaky-Wave HPM Antennas

Abstract

This report describes progress during the 3rd quarter of this program and summarizes the current status of the research. Our primary technical activities this period consisted of investigating the effects of mutual coupling between leaky-wave channels and extending/ improving our evolving toolset for the design of HPM-capable forward-traveling leaky-wave antennas.
